Transaction f7674097efcca498f7b837ac65da165e2251db49db716875c791d4f2b0abfc3a
1 Input
1 Output
-
f7674097efcca498f7b837ac65da165e2251db49db716875c791d4f2b0abfc3a:0
- value
- 999516
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 52143284c5b2bc8b4c53a658cad642db7d9b6bad OP_EQUAL
- address
- 39B1XcJhPACobGQumwmgwy7Fsp91GG2n8z